Join Chef Gilley on a journey to build the foundation of a well-stocked Asian pantry.
In this hands-on class, Chef Gilley introduces you to two sauces and a dressing that will infuse any and all of your meals with authentic Asian flavors in no time.
Chef Gilley will begin by teaching on how to outfit your pantry with necessary Asian ingredients to always have on hand so you can whip up these sauces and this dressing anytime. Of course, you won't just be making sauces — you'll also prepare a beautiful salad for your dressing, a classic noodle bowl for one sauce and stir-fry for the other!
Guests are welcome to bring wine and beer to enjoy during the class.
Honey-Miso Ginger Dressing
With baby arugula, roasted carrots, apples and goat cheese
Chili Noodle Sauce
A quick take on classic zha jiang mian with scallions and cucumbers
Black Bean BBQ Sauce
With stir-fried broccoli and tofu

Chef Gilley is passionate about teaching the beauty of Chinese cuisine and hosting cooking classes to share his knowledge and experience with others. In the past, he has operated an extension of his family's restaurant at a weekly food fest in Brooklyn, and is currently serving up delectable dishes as a sous chef in New York. Chef Gilley is famous for his cold sesame noodles, which have been heralded by Gourmet Magazine and the New York Times.
